bio filter for fish pond

A bio filter for fish pond is an essential component that maintains water quality through biological filtration processes. This sophisticated system utilizes beneficial bacteria to break down harmful substances like ammonia and nitrites into less toxic compounds. The filter consists of multiple layers of media, including mechanical filtration materials that trap solid waste and biological media that house nitrifying bacteria. These bacteria colonies naturally process waste products, converting them into safer substances for fish. The system typically incorporates various technological features such as adjustable flow rates, easy-access cleaning ports, and modular designs that allow for customization based on pond size. Modern bio filters often include UV sterilization capabilities to eliminate harmful pathogens and control algae growth. The applications of bio filters extend from small decorative ponds to large-scale aquaculture operations, making them versatile solutions for maintaining healthy aquatic environments. They work continuously to maintain optimal water conditions, requiring minimal maintenance while providing maximum efficiency in waste processing. The technology behind these filters has evolved to include smart monitoring systems that can alert owners to changes in water quality parameters, ensuring consistent performance and fish health.

Advanced Biological Processing Technology

Advanced Biological Processing Technology

The bio filter's core strength lies in its sophisticated biological processing capability, which harnesses natural bacterial colonies to transform harmful waste products. This system creates a complete nitrogen cycle within the pond environment, efficiently converting toxic ammonia through nitrites to less harmful nitrates. The filter media is specifically designed to maximize surface area for bacterial colonization, providing optimal conditions for biological filtration. This technology operates continuously, maintaining consistent water quality without the need for chemical interventions. The biological processing occurs in multiple stages, ensuring thorough waste breakdown and preventing the accumulation of harmful compounds. This natural approach to filtration creates a stable, self-sustaining ecosystem that benefits all pond inhabitants.
